coppermine doesn't have it's own smtp engine (which sends email), but has to rely on the smtp engine that has to be set up on your server. Most Lunix servers come with smtp properly set up, but IIS doesn't.
Since you're using IIS, you'll have to set up / configure your smtp server first. If you're sure that smtp server is set up correctly on your webserver, you might have to enter the correct data into include/mailer.inc.php:
Code: [Select]
$CONFIG['smtp_host'] = '';
$CONFIG['smtp_username'] = '';
$CONFIG['smtp_password'] = '';
(but remember: you'll have to get smtp to work in the first place!).
